Dimensions and Capacity of 30 Feet Containers
A 30 feet container primarily can be found in 2 types: standard and high cube. Below, you will discover a table showcasing the dimensions and capacities for both types.
Container TypeLength (Feet)Width (Feet)Height (Feet)Internal Volume (Cubic Feet)Max Payload (lbs)Standard3088.51,84551,000High Cube3089.51,98851,000Advantages of Using a 30 Feet Container

2. How much does a 30 feet container weigh?
The weight of a 30 feet container varies based on its type (standard or high cube) but normally varies from 4,000 to 8,000 pounds when empty. The maximum payload capability has to do with 51,000 pounds, that includes freight weight.
